Output 5de90881d244cef7b0d41f7f08172ec3e38bd5e5d2112fc2a2decd37496a10ee:3

value
31770000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90c2afbb8d9f03d5b1ff668b6f1fc61ce189de7f OP_EQUAL
address
3EtSTDgMrEFxV5fTKNbR3mwGKsF68BqNbf
transaction
5de90881d244cef7b0d41f7f08172ec3e38bd5e5d2112fc2a2decd37496a10ee
spent
true